Key concepts and overview

Licensing and regulation are fundamental concepts in the online gambling industry. A license is an official permission granted by a governing body that allows an online casino to operate legally. Regulatory authorities are responsible for overseeing these casinos to ensure they adhere to strict standards of fairness, security, and responsible gambling practices. In Canada, players often look for casinos licensed by recognized jurisdictions such as the United Kingdom, Malta, or Gibraltar, as these are known for their rigorous regulatory frameworks.

Understanding these concepts helps players make informed decisions. A licensed casino is more likely to provide a fair gaming experience, as they are subject to regular audits and must comply with specific operational standards. This oversight protects players from fraud and ensures that their personal and financial information is secure.

Main features and details

The licensing process involves several steps, including application, review, and approval by the regulatory authority. Casinos must demonstrate their financial stability, operational integrity, and commitment to responsible gaming. Once licensed, they are required to maintain compliance with the regulations set forth by the authority, which may include regular reporting and audits.

  • Types of Licenses: Different jurisdictions offer various types of licenses, each with its own set of requirements and regulations. For example, the UK Gambling Commission is known for its strict standards, while other jurisdictions may have more lenient regulations.
  • Player Protection: Licensed casinos are obligated to implement measures that protect players, such as self-exclusion programs and responsible gambling tools.
  • Fair Play Assurance: Regulatory bodies often require casinos to use random number generators (RNGs) to ensure that game outcomes are fair and unbiased.

Advantages and disadvantages

Like any system, licensing and regulation come with their pros and cons. Here are some advantages:

  • Player Safety: Licensed casinos are held to high standards, ensuring player safety and fair play.
  • Dispute Resolution: Regulatory bodies often provide mechanisms for players to resolve disputes with casinos.
  • Trust and Credibility: A license from a reputable authority enhances a casino’s credibility, attracting more players.

However, there are also disadvantages:

  • Limited Options: Some players may find that their favorite casinos are not licensed in their jurisdiction, limiting their options.
  • Compliance Costs: Casinos may pass on the costs of compliance to players in the form of lower bonuses or higher wagering requirements.
